European Boxing Championships 1957

from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

The 12th men's European boxing championships for amateurs were held from May 25 to June 2, 1957 in the Czechoslovak capital, Prague . 149 fighters from 21 nations took part.

Medals were awarded in ten weight classes. The Soviet Union won three medals, making it the best team.
